企业级翻译解决方案来了!Hunyuan-MT-7B-WEBUI支持民汉互译
在政府公文需要快速译成维吾尔语、藏族学生希望实时理解汉语教材的今天,语言不应成为信息平等的障碍。然而现实是,大多数高质量翻译模型仍停留在论文和权重文件中——下载后面对一堆命令行参数和环境依赖,非技术人员往往望而却步。有没有一种方式,能让一线工作人员点几下鼠标就用上顶尖AI翻译能力?
答案正是Hunyuan-MT-7B-WEBUI:它不是又一个“仅供研究”的开源项目,而是一套真正为企业和机构准备的“即插即用”翻译系统。从新疆某地州政务平台到高校民族语言实验室,这套方案正悄然改变着多语言交互的落地路径。
为什么我们需要专用翻译模型?
很多人以为,通用大模型如Qwen或ChatGLM也能做翻译,何必再搞一套独立系统?这背后其实藏着一个关键误解:通用 ≠ 专业。
就像一辆家用SUV无法胜任赛车场上的极限操控,通用大模型虽然能“说出”一段译文,但在术语准确性、句式结构保持、低资源语言覆盖等方面,往往力不从心。尤其是在处理藏语诗歌的韵律、维吾尔语复杂的格变化时,普通模型容易出现漏翻、错序甚至语义扭曲。
Hunyuan-MT-7B 的不同之处在于,它是腾讯混元体系中专为翻译任务生的。70亿参数看似不大,但全部精力都聚焦在“如何把一句话精准转述成另一种语言”。它的训练数据经过严格筛选,包含大量真实场景下的双语平行语料,比如法律条文、医疗说明、教育读本,并针对我国5种主要少数民族语言(藏、维、蒙、哈、彝)做了专项增强。
更关键的是,它采用了多语言统一建模架构——所有语言共享同一套参数空间,通过语言标识符控制输入输出方向。这意味着模型不仅能节省部署成本,还能实现“跨语言迁移”:即便某种语言的数据较少,也能借助其他语言的知识提升翻译质量。例如,在缺乏足够彝汉对照文本的情况下,系统可以通过西班牙语或法语的丰富语料间接学习句法模式,从而反哺彝语翻译效果。
实际表现如何?在WMT25国际机器翻译大赛中,该模型在30个语言对评测中拿下第一;在Flores-200测试集上,其藏语→中文的BLEU得分比同类7B模型高出近8分。这不是简单的数字游戏,而是意味着政策文件中的“兜底保障”不会被误译为“地面保护”,医学报告里的“慢性炎症”也不会变成“慢性的火”。
工程化交付:让AI走出实验室
如果说模型能力决定了“能不能翻得好”,那么工程封装则决定了“能不能让人用得上”。这才是 Hunyuan-MT-7B-WEBUI 真正突破的地方。
传统AI项目的典型流程是:算法团队训练出模型 → 打包权重发给工程组 → 后者花两周配置环境、调试接口 → 最终交付一个只有API文档的服务。整个过程高度依赖专业人员,一旦换人维护就可能出问题。
而 Hunyuan-MT-7B-WEBUI 换了一种思路:把整个推理链路打包成一个可运行的“软件盒子”。你拿到的不是一个.bin文件,而是一个完整的Docker镜像,里面已经装好了:
- CUDA驱动与PyTorch框架
- 经过优化的模型权重
- Gradio构建的Web前端
- 自动启动脚本
用户只需三步:拉取镜像 → 运行脚本 → 浏览器访问。全程无需写一行代码,也不用担心Python版本冲突或缺少某个依赖库。
一键启动的背后
看看这个名为1键启动.sh的脚本:
#!/bin/bash echo "正在准备环境..." source /opt/conda/bin/activate hunyuan-mt cd /root/hunyuan-mt-webui python app.py \ --model-name-or-path "/models/Hunyuan-MT-7B" \ --device "cuda" \ --dtype "float16" \ --max-seq-length 1024 \ --port 7860 \ --share false echo "服务已启动,请前往控制台点击【网页推理】访问!"短短十几行,却完成了环境激活、路径切换、半精度加载、端口绑定等一系列操作。其中--dtype float16是关键——它启用FP16推理,使显存占用降低40%以上,让RTX 3090这类消费级显卡也能流畅运行。对于预算有限的基层单位来说,这意味着不必专门采购A100服务器也能享受高性能翻译服务。
再看前端界面的核心逻辑:
def translate(text, src_lang, tgt_lang): inputs = f"<{src_lang}>->{<tgt_lang>}: {text}" input_tokens = tokenizer(inputs, return_tensors="pt", truncation=True, max_length=512).to("cuda") outputs = model.generate( input_tokens.input_ids, max_new_tokens=512, num_beams=4, early_stopping=True ) result = tokenizer.decode(outputs[0], skip_special_tokens=True) return result这里用了一个巧妙的设计:通过<zh>-><ug>这样的前缀提示来明确翻译方向。相比传统做法中靠外部路由判断语种,这种方式更稳定、不易出错,尤其适合同时支持33种语言的复杂场景。
最终呈现给用户的,是一个简洁直观的Gradio页面:
- 输入框清晰标注“请输入要翻译的文本”
- 下拉菜单列出常用语种,包括“维吾尔语(ug)”、“藏语(bo)”
- 点击“翻译”按钮后,结果即时显示,支持复制与清空
这种设计看似简单,实则是对用户体验的深度考量——毕竟真正使用它的,可能是只会用电脑查邮件的社区工作者,而不是每天敲命令行的工程师。
实际应用场景:不只是“翻译一下”
这套系统最打动人的地方,在于它解决了几个长期存在的现实难题。
政务公开提速60%
在新疆某地州政府的信息公开办公室,过去将一份5000字的惠民政策文件翻译成维吾尔语,需要两名双语干部协作3小时以上:一人初翻,另一人校对。而现在,工作人员先用 Hunyuan-MT-7B-WEBUI 自动生成初稿,重点核对专业术语和政策表述即可,整体效率提升超60%。更重要的是,机器生成的译文风格统一,避免了人工翻译时常有的表达差异。
教育资源普惠落地
青海一所藏汉双语学校的教师反馈,以前备课时查找参考资料极为困难,很多优质汉语教学内容无法及时引入课堂。现在他们在校内服务器部署了该系统,老师可以随时将知识点摘要翻译成藏语,制作成课件发放给学生。有位数学老师甚至用它翻译了几何题干,帮助学生跨越语言障碍理解抽象概念。
医疗沟通零延迟
在内蒙古某县级医院,蒙古族老年患者常因语言不通难以准确描述病情。接诊医生通过平板电脑连接本地部署的翻译系统,实现了“你说我翻”的即时交流。尽管仍需医生复核关键信息,但初步问诊时间缩短了一半以上,极大缓解了医患沟通压力。
这些案例共同说明一点:当AI工具足够易用时,它就能真正融入业务流程,而不是作为一个“炫技展示”被束之高阁。
部署建议与最佳实践
当然,好用不代表可以盲目上线。我们在多个现场部署中总结出以下几点经验:
硬件选择要务实
- 推荐配置:NVIDIA T4 / RTX 3090及以上,显存≥8GB
- 最低可用:GTX 1660 Ti(6GB显存),但需开启INT8量化,响应时间约3–5秒/句
- 纯CPU模式:可行,但需32GB内存,仅适合极低并发场景
特别提醒:不要试图在Mac M系列芯片上运行原始镜像——虽然Apple Silicon对LLM支持越来越好,但当前Docker容器中的CUDA依赖会导致兼容问题。若必须使用Mac,建议通过远程连接调用Linux服务器上的实例。
安全策略不能少
生产环境中务必注意:
- 关闭公网暴露,采用内网访问或VPN接入
- 使用Nginx反向代理增加一层防护
- 添加基础身份验证(如HTTP Basic Auth)
- 对敏感领域(如司法、军事)文本设置自动过滤机制
我们曾见过某单位直接将翻译系统挂在外网,导致内部文件被批量抓取。技术本身无罪,但防护意识必须跟上。
可持续优化才是长久之计
虽然开箱即用很爽,但真正的价值在于持续迭代:
- 定期更新镜像版本,获取新语种和性能改进
- 结合LoRA微调,在特定领域(如电力、交通)进一步提升准确率
- 收集用户反馈,建立“错误样本库”用于后续训练
有个客户的做法值得借鉴:他们在系统后台增加了“举报错误翻译”按钮,收集到的问题每周汇总一次,由语言专家标注后反馈给技术团队。半年后,该系统的本地化术语准确率提升了22%。
走向普惠的AI基础设施
Hunyuan-MT-7B-WEBUI 的意义,远不止于“又一个多语言模型”。它代表了一种新的AI产品范式:不再只发布模型权重,而是交付完整的能力单元。
这种“模型+界面+脚本”的一体化设计,正在成为连接科研与产业的关键桥梁。未来我们或许会看到更多类似形态的产品出现——不是以GitHub仓库的形式,而是作为标准化的Docker镜像、Kubernetes Helm包,甚至是U盘即插即用的边缘设备。
当一名乡镇干部能在五分钟内启动一个世界级翻译引擎时,人工智能才算真正开始服务于每一个人。而这,正是技术应有的温度。